AeroVironment, Inc., a leading provider of unmanned aircraft systems (UAS) and electric vehicle (EV) charging solutions, is headquartered in the United States. Founded in 1971, the company has established itself as a pioneer in the aerospace and defence industry, focusing on innovative technologies that enhance operational efficiency and safety. With a strong presence in both military and commercial sectors, AeroVironment offers a range of products, including the renowned Raven and Wasp drones, which are distinguished by their advanced capabilities and ease of use. The company has achieved significant milestones, including numerous contracts with the U.S. Department of Defence, solidifying its position as a trusted partner in critical missions. AeroVironment, Inc., headquartered in the US, currently does not have publicly available carbon emissions data for the most recent year, nor specific reduction targets or initiatives outlined in their climate commitments. Without concrete figures or defined goals, it is challenging to assess their current carbon footprint or climate strategy.
